Checklist
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.
- Log sell through by account for the first eight weeks.
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.

Frequently asked questions
What is the first step for Flux Lite in a new market?
Confirm the local regulatory position and labelling requirements; everything else follows from that.
Do you support long term supply agreements?
Yes, rolling agreements with defined review points work better for both sides than rigid annual commitments.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
